Coolors helps Webflow designers quickly generate, refine, and export cohesive color palettes that can be directly applied to their projects' style guide and design system.
When building a Webflow site, establishing a consistent color scheme early is critical—especially for client projects where brand identity needs to be translated into reusable styles. Coolors allows you to explore trending palettes, generate harmonious color combinations with a single spacebar press, or fine-tune individual hues until they're pixel-perfect. Once you've locked in your palette, you can export hex codes and immediately add them as global swatches in Webflow's Style Manager, ensuring consistency across typography, backgrounds, buttons, and interactions. This eliminates the guesswork of choosing complementary colors and speeds up the design handoff process, particularly when working with clients who lack a defined brand guide.
Unlike static palette libraries, Coolors offers real-time adjustments and accessibility contrast checkers, making it easier to meet WCAG standards without leaving your workflow. You can also save and organize multiple palettes for different projects or client brands, streamlining multi-site agency work.

Coolors is a color palette generator accessed via their website. Generate or browse palettes, export color codes (HEX, RGB, etc.), then manually apply them to your Webflow project by adding the colors to your site's style guide or directly to element styles.

Coolors offers a free tier with basic palette generation and browsing. Pro plans unlock features like palette history, advanced export options, and collection management. The free version is typically sufficient for most Webflow design needs and color exploration.
